Set along a quiet canal in Santa Rosa Beach, 153 Bluebell Circle offers a kind of waterfront living that feels both private and effortless. Built in 2020 and positioned on nearly 0.4 acres, the property pairs newer construction with the space and dock access that have become increasingly difficult to find along this stretch of the Emerald Coast. From here, the Gulf, Scenic Highway 30A, and the restaurants and shops of Grand Boulevard are all just a short drive away. The four-bedroom, four-bath home spans just under 3,000 square feet, with a layout designed around natural light and an easy connection between indoor and outdoor spaces. Clean coastal architecture defines the interiors, simple lines, warm textures, and an openness that keeps the home feeling relaxed rather than formal.
Outside, the setting takes over. A screened pool and patio anchor the backyard, creating a space that works as well for quiet mornings as it does for evenings with friends. A covered outdoor kitchen and dining area, finished with a wood plank ceiling, extends the living space even further. Just beyond, a private dock reaches into the canal, offering easy access for boating, paddleboarding, or simply watching the light move across the water at the end of the day.
